Join servers that are missing 3 / 5 players, never join one thats missing 1 player cause they are almost always rolls, it's not fool proof but if you get on a server just starting up and help to populate it then the games can be quiet fun, for a few rounds at least, but the stackers will arrive and ruin everything at some point.
Other things that i do upon joining before clicking that spawn button
Tab and check the ranks on both teams, it is a flawed check i know, but invaribly the team with the more Colonel's wins. Check the number of same clan members on a single team, it only takes a squad full most of the time to win a game so keep an eye on that, also check the scores and k/d ratio as well to get more of an understanding.
Look at the map, see how many flags you own / how many Mcom stations are left as well as the tickets left, a team floudnering on stage 1 of rush with 25 tickets left having not got close to either station will more than likely loose.
Where your team actually are on the map, if they areAll gathered around the same area and none of them are at least watching the other flanks then it shows a lack of tactical awareness of the whole team. If the vast majority of them are Skull and bones on the deck then they are most likely cannon fodder, If there is hardly any red triangles on the map it shows that your team are not spotting enemies.
Then lastly check the squads tab, If there are players in squads, there is room to join and they have squad perks then have a look at the class they are rolling and the perks they have, 3x More ammo and all of them snipers says a whole lot about what they'll be acheiving in the game. and as a rule of thumb (for me anyway) anything more than "3 Players not in a squad" mostly means that the team is destined to loose.
Takes about 30 seconds to work out now if a team stands a chance of winning, if there isn't even a remote chance dont stick around, leave and find another server dont click spawn and you wont have any record of ever being on the server so if you care about your stats they won't be touched.
